Le Canada se caractérise par un niveau élevé de bien-être, et sa croissance économique s’est redressée, grâce au rebond des exportations et au renforcement de l’investissement des entreprises. L’orientation expansionniste des politiques macroéconomiques se réduit progressivement, et les politiques budgétaires sont viables à long terme, même si des diffi cultés subsistent au niveau provincial.

This report reviews the literature on the impact of real-time information provision on consumer decision-making. In addition, it describes the results of a study in which about 7000 households in Ontario, Canada were provided with in-home displays linked to smart meters that provided real-time feedback on electricity consumption.

Canada’s population is slightly healthier than the OECD average, considering life expectancy and other general measures of health status. Smoking and alcohol consumption are also a little lower than the OECD average, but obesity rates are high. Indicators for access and quality of care are generally good, achieved with a level of health spending not much higher than the OECD average.
